Переглянути джерело

数据查询控制数据量

maxiaoshan 2 роки тому
батько
коміт
d5931e62fd
2 змінених файлів з 11 додано та 5 видалено
  1. 5 5
      src/lua/data.go
  2. 6 0
      src/web/templates/lua/datafind.html

+ 5 - 5
src/lua/data.go

@@ -105,22 +105,22 @@ func (l *Lua) SearchData() {
 	}
 	qu.Debug("bidding 搜索完成...")
 	//2、找bidding_file附件信息
-	list_file, _ := util.JYMgo.Find("bidding_file", query, nil, Fields, false, -1, -1)
+	list_file, _ := util.JYMgo.Find("bidding_file", query, `{"_id":-1}`, Fields, false, 0, 20)
 	AddVal(*list_file, "bidding_file", &data)
 	qu.Debug("bidding_file 搜索完成...", len(*list_file))
 	//3、找spider_repeatdata判重数据表
-	list_repeat, _ := util.MgoS.Find("spider_repeatdata", query, nil, Fields, false, -1, -1)
+	list_repeat, _ := util.MgoS.Find("spider_repeatdata", query, `{"_id":-1}`, Fields, false, 0, 20)
 	AddVal(*list_repeat, "spider_repeatdata", &data)
 	qu.Debug("spider_repeatdata 搜索完成...", len(*list_repeat))
 	//4、找spider_warn异常数据表
-	list_warn, _ := util.MgoS.Find("spider_warn", query, nil, Fields, false, -1, -1)
+	list_warn, _ := util.MgoS.Find("spider_warn", query, `{"_id":-1}`, Fields, false, 0, 20)
 	AddVal(*list_warn, "spider_warn", &data)
 	qu.Debug("spider_warn 搜索完成...", len(*list_warn))
 	//5、找data_bak表
-	list_bak_lua, _ := util.MgoS.Find("data_bak", query, nil, Fields, false, -1, -1)
+	list_bak_lua, _ := util.MgoS.Find("data_bak", query, `{"_id":-1}`, Fields, false, 0, 20)
 	AddVal(*list_bak_lua, "lua-data_bak", &data)
 	qu.Debug("lua-data_bak 搜索完成...", len(*list_bak_lua))
-	list_bak_py, _ := util.MgoPy.Find("data_bak", query, nil, Fields, false, -1, -1)
+	list_bak_py, _ := util.MgoPy.Find("data_bak", query, `{"_id":-1}`, Fields, false, 0, 20)
 	AddVal(*list_bak_py, "python-data_bak", &data)
 	qu.Debug("python-data_bak 搜索完成...", len(*list_bak_py))
 	//if len(data) == 0 { //以上都没有找到数据,找列表页数据

+ 6 - 0
src/web/templates/lua/datafind.html

@@ -65,6 +65,7 @@
                                 <th>编号</th>
                                 <th>id</th>
                                 <th>标题</th>
+                                <th>入库时间</th>
                                 <th>发布时间</th>
                                 <th>来源</th>
                                 <th>索引</th>
@@ -116,6 +117,11 @@
                         tmp = '<a class="" target="_blank" href=' + v.href + '>' + v.title + '</a>';
                         return tmp
                     }},
+                {"data":  function(v,a,row){
+                    var dt = new Date()
+                    dt.setTime(parseInt(v.comeintime) * 1000);
+                    return dt.format("yyyy-MM-dd hh:mm:ss");
+                }},
                 {"data":  function(v,a,row){
                     var publishtime
                     if (v.by == "spider_warn"){